Class Conflict
Refers to tensions and antagonisms in society arising from the socio-economic interests of people belonging to different social classes.
Marx's Theory
A social, political, and economic philosophy named after Karl Marx, which examines the effect of capitalism on labor, productivity, and economic development and argues for a worker revolution to overturn capitalism in favor of communism.
Weber's Theory
Max Weber's sociological framework that emphasizes the importance of social actions and the structures of society, including class, status, and power.
Subjective Meanings
Refers to the personal, internal interpretations and understandings individuals have about the world around them.
